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31701109 693317 729208
723032554 06085038 17792257497
723032554 06085038 17792257497
082245527 566195272 458 439806960
All about undefined
Interested in learning more?
723032554 06085038 17792257497
082245527 566195272 458 439806960
See more
136695 29837764
187420279 0495960 08304257
See more
5292120 983 7704656
3431 3404293349 88
See more